- 締切済み
モーショントゥィーンに関する質問です
よろしくお願いします。 モーショントゥィーンに関する質問です。 例えば、1フレームめにムービークリップを配置し、モーショントゥィーンを作成します。 50フレームにキーフレームを挿入。ムービークリップを下方に移動します。つぎに100フレームめにキーフレームを挿入し左下に移動。ここまでは普通に動いてくれます。次に150フレームめにキーフレームを挿入しますが、1フレームと同じ位置に戻したいと思います。タイムラインは150フレームで終わりにします。150フレームにアクションスクリプトで1フレームに飛ばし、このムービーを繰り返したいのです。 動きとしては一つのオブジェクトが上から下、下から左下、と左下から上と、スムーズに動くモーションです。この時、1フレームの位置にオブジェクトを戻したいので、1フレームをコピーして150フレームにペーストしても●のキーフレームになってしまい、モーションすることができません。アクションスクリプトで150フレームから1フレームに飛ばし、再生するとムービーが、カクッとコマが飛んだ感じになり、滑らかさがなくなります。どのようにすれば、スムーズに動かすことができるでしょうか?ちなみにに使用FlashはCS6です。 よろしくお願いします
- みんなの回答 (1)
- 専門家の回答
みんなの回答
- chuntotto
- ベストアンサー率100% (1/1)
アクションスクリプトで飛ばさねばならないのでしょうか。 CS5ですが フレーム1を選択→画像を作成、シンボル変換→50フレームを選んで「フレームを作成」 →「モーショントゥイーンを作成」→シンボルを移動させる(自動的にキーフレームが挿入される) →100フレームを選んで「フレーム作成」→モーショントゥイーンのTLが勝手に伸びる →シンボルを移動させる→150フレームを選んで「フレームを作成」→同じくTLが伸びる ここでいったんフレーム1に戻り、インスタンスを選択してプロパティからX座標とY座標をメモります。(添付画像参照) (別に最初にメモしてもかまわないのですが) 再び150フレームに戻り、インスタンスを選択し、上記の座標を記入します。 プレビューするとぬるぬる動きます。 他のオブジェクトとの兼ね合いがあるのでしたら、最初にシンボルに変換してインスタンスを作成した際に、そのインスタンス内のTLで上記の操作を行えば、このインスタンスだけ、同じ動作を繰り返し行うことになります。